On August 6th and 7th, women from all around the world will play two rounds of disc golf at their local participating PDGA Women's Global Event. Scores from the first two rounds of each participating tournament will be submitted by the individual tournament directors and rated by the PDGA. These round ratings will be totaled and averaged to determine the player's "Global Score." For the rounds to qualify, the event must include two rounds and have at least three ratings propagators playing on the same course layout each round for ratings to be calculated as accurately as possible. Please note, this year the exact same course layout no longer must be used for both rounds. The global results will be updated throughout the day to determine our PDGA Women’s Global Event Champions and the winner in each division will receive a memorable trophy.
*Note for Juniors 12 and Under: As in previous years, Juniors 12 and under will have only one round (August 6th or 7th, 2022) included into the overall PDGA Women’s Global Event.
